“…According to these studies, the time interval from initial surgery to IBTR (disease-free interval) was one of the most important predictors of disease recurrence after IBTR [3,4,5,6,8,9,10,11,12,13,14,15,16]. Patients with IBTR >5 years after breast-conserving surgery have a better prognosis than patients with earlier IBTR [8,13,15,16]. However, it is not rare for patients with IBTR >5 years after initial surgery to develop systemic recurrence [6,13,16].…”
